AMENDMENT 2.01 Article N entitled, "District Regulations" of Chapter 13, entitled "Zoning" of the Code of Ordinances of the Town of Trophy Club, Texas, is hereby amended to revise Section 4.16 (M)(7)(a)(i)-(vi) AND (M)(7)(b) to reads as follows: M. Masonry Requirement: I. All principal and accessory buildings and structures shall be of exterior fire resistant construction having one hundred percent (100%) of the total exterior walls, excluding doors, windows and porches, constructed of brick or stone including the area above the first floor ceiling plate line. 2. Painted tilt wall and painted concrete block shall not be permitted as finished masonry material. 3. Stucco shall be used only as an accent material subject to prior approval of P & Z. 4. All other chimneys surfaces shall also be of brick, stone, or stucco. 5. Other materials of equal characteristics may be allowed upon approval of the Planning and Zoning Commission. 6. Masonry materials shall be of earth tones and shall be submitted to the Planning and Zoning Commission for recommendation and to the Town Council for approval. For the purpose of this section, earth tones shall be understood to consist of darker and pastel shades of the color spectrum, which may generally be found in the natural environment. These colors shall not generally consist of the vibrants or fluorescents of the color spectrum. 7. The Town Council upon either negative or positive recommendation from the Planning & Zoning Commission shall have the power to modify masonry regulations where the literal enforcement of this Ordinance would result in practical difficulty or unnecessary hardship and the relief granted would not be contrary to the public interest but would do substantial justice in accordance with the spirit of the Ordinance. a. For the purpose of this Ordinance, the following are established as general conditions, ALL of which shall be met upon granting any waiver or modification to the masonry requirements as outlined in this Section. (i) No diminution value of surrounding properties would be suffered; and Granting the permit would be of benefit to the public interest and surrounding properties; and A zoning restriction as applied to the owner's property interferes with the (iii) reasonable use of the property, considering the unique setting of the property in its environment; and (iv) By granting the permit, substantial justice would be done; and (v) The use must not be contrary to the spirit of the Ordinance. b. The burden of demonstrating all general conditions have been met and that a modification is appropriate is upon the person requesting the modification. The Town Council and Planning & Zoning Commission may require a person requesting a modification to provide proof as each body determines necessary and appropriate for the Planning & Zoning Commission and the Town Council to evaluate the application for modification. SAVINGS AND REPEALER That this Ordinance shall be cumulative of all other Ordinances of the Town affecting Masonry Criteria within the CR Zoning District and shall not repeal any of the provisions of such Ordinances except in those instances where provisions of those Ordinances are in direct conflict with the provisions of this Ordinance; whether such Ordinances are codified or uncodified, and all other provisions of the Ordinances of the Town of Trophy Club, codified or uncodified, not in conflict with the provisions of this Ordinance, shall remain in full force and effect. Notwithstanding the foregoing, any complaint, action, cause of action or claim which prior to the effective date of this Ordinance has been initiated or has arisen under or pursuant to such repealed Ordinance(s) shall continue to be governed by the provisions of that Ordinance and for that purpose the Ordinance shall be deemed to remain and continue in full force and effect. PENALTY It shall be unlawful for any person to violate any provision of this Ordinance, and any person violating or failing to comply with any provision hereof shall be fined, upon conviction, in an amount not more than Two Thousand Dollars ($2,000.00), and a separate offense shall be deemed committed each day during or on which a violation occurs or continues.
